CAS 33401-01-3

:

[(3S,4R,5S,6S)-5-acetamido-4-acetoxy-6-benzyloxy-2-(hydroxymethyl)tetrahydropyran-3-yl] acetate

Description:
The chemical substance with the name "[(3S,4R,5S,6S)-5-acetamido-4-acetoxy-6-benzyloxy-2-(hydroxymethyl)tetrahydropyran-3-yl] acetate" and CAS number 33401-01-3 is a complex organic compound characterized by its tetrahydropyran ring structure, which is a six-membered cyclic ether. This compound features multiple functional groups, including an acetamido group, acetoxy group, and benzyloxy group, contributing to its reactivity and potential biological activity. The presence of hydroxymethyl indicates that it has a hydroxyl group attached to a carbon chain, enhancing its solubility in polar solvents. The stereochemistry, indicated by the (3S,4R,5S,6S) configuration, suggests specific spatial arrangements of atoms that can influence the compound's interactions with biological systems. Such compounds are often studied for their potential applications in pharmaceuticals, particularly in the development of glycosides or as intermediates in synthetic pathways. Overall, this compound exemplifies the complexity and diversity of organic molecules in medicinal chemistry.
